MEETING OF COMMUNITY PARTNERS ADDRESSING HOMELESSNESS IN PORTERVILLE TAKES PLACES AT CITY HALL

A strategic planning meeting of community partners to address homelessness in the Porterville area took place at Porterville City Hall on Wednesday, January 12, 2023. Approximately forty (40) participants attended, representing the County of Tulare, including Tulare County Board of Supervisors Chair, Dennis Townsend, City of Porterville Mayor, Martha A. Flores, and Councilmember Raymond Beltran. The purpose of the meeting was to strengthen partnerships and to cohesively adopt realistic goals and measurable outcomes to address and reduce homelessness in the Porterville community.

City staff presented Point in Time Count data from June 2022. The Point in Time Count provides service agencies and local governments a snapshot of patterns and trends of the homeless community throughout Kings and Tulare Counties, which helps the agencies apply for funding and secure the proper tools to meet those needs. To find out more about Point in Time, visit: Point In Time — Kings/Tulare Homeless Alliance (kthomelessalliance.org). Porterville Police Chief, Jake Castellow and Police Captain Dominic Barteau also provided an overview of the newly formed Special Methods and Resources Team (SMART), in addition to providing a summary of the successful partnerships which have been formed to assist individuals experiencing homelessness connect to housing and resources.

The meeting participants strategized and identified goals like securing housing units to increase the feasibility of applying for additional funding and having measurable outcomes.

Participants also had the opportunity to contribute to the development of the 2023/24 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Action Plan.
